Web1 de jan. de 1997 · Newborns may have very high serum γGT, up to 5–8 times the upper limit of normal for adults, that rapidly declines to adult concentrations by age 6 months (see Table 1). Premature infants may have even higher γGT values than full-term infants during the first several days after birth. Web16 de mar. de 2024 · After birth, most term and late preterm newborn infants ≥35 weeks gestation make a successful transition to extrauterine life and require only routine newborn care. This topic will provide a summary of routine care for healthy newborn infants ≥35 weeks gestation. The assessment of the newborn is discussed in greater detail elsewhere.
